Arrests made after commercial burglaries

As stated by Detective Sergeant Dave Wilson, Officer in Charge, Levin CIB:

Levin Police have made three arrests in relation to a number of commercial burglaries.

As a result of a number of search warrants, Police have recovered a substantial amount of stolen property.

Two men, aged 18 and 19, have been arrested and are currently before the courts, charged with burglary.

They will appear in the Levin District Court on 22 August.

One minor has been referred to Youth Aid.

Enquiries are ongoing at this time.
